@ARTICLE{Vaziri, author = {Vaziri, Roya and Mirzaei, Roohallah and Soleymani, Haddad and }, title = {Introduction to Environmental Statistics and Related International Frameworks }, volume = {20}, number = {2}, abstract ={ In the literature of economic planning and policy making, having access to accurate and up-to-date statistics and information, which are the basis of decision-making, is a high priority among factors such as natural resources, financial resources, workforce, proper and progressive technology. Statistics and information have a significant role in the stages of planning (policies and goals), directing administrative affairs, and function assessment. The comprehensive system of environmental statistics is not needed just for assessing the current status of the environment, but also is essential for plan preparation, policy formulation, and sustainable development and the environment protection activities. Therefore, providing comprehensive environmental statistics would make it convenient to meet the Goals of the 5th Chapter of the 4th Development Program (Articles 58-71), In other words, according to the Article 50 of the Constitution, the Goals of the 5th Chapter of the 4th Development Program of the Country (Articles 58-71), Stockholm Declaration, Chapter 8 of the Agenda 21 and especially Part D of the same chapter, Chapter 40 of the Agenda 21, UNEP's, UNSD's and UNDSD's Recommendations, and Millennium Development Goals, organizing, providing and publishing environmental statistics seems to be necessary. This paper discusses and reviews environmental statistics concepts, the essence of providing environmental statistics and indices, different types of data, statistics sources, environmental indices and indicators, environmental statistics data collection methods, different parts of environmental statistics, and different types of international frameworks of environmental statistics. }, URL = {http://ijoss.srtc.ac.ir/article-1-81-en.html}, eprint = {http://ijoss.srtc.ac.ir/article-1-81-en.pdf}, journal = {Iranian Journal of Official Statistics Studies}, doi = {}, year = {2010} }
